Description

War with Myself is an eye-opening, heartfelt memoir of one woman’s struggle with bulimia, which seeks to help others find their own path to healing and go beyond ‘scratching the surface’ of what it’s really like to be so deeply in battle with an eating disorder.

The abuse and bullying Shani-Lee Wallis suffered as a child scarred her deeply. Desperate to change, and to gain control over the narrative of her life, she found herself embroiled in a battle – not with the perpetrators, but with herself. These events, and Shani-Lee’s struggle to overcome them led to a devastating condition; she became one of an estimated 1.25 million people in the UK and 30 million in the US to suffer with an eating disorder.

Courageously, Shani-Lee fought for her life and eventually found love and happiness. She has chosen to share her compelling story in the hope that people engaged in similar battles will find healing and peace. War with Myself is part memoir, part self-help. By sharing her raw, difficult story and the tools for change, Shani-Lee aims to educate and aid recovery. Within this book’s pages, readers from all walks of life will find daily activities that can help on the road to healing and wellbeing.

“People need to be educated on what can trigger the onset of Bulimia. Much of society still think it’s based on weight-related issues. Often, it is stemmed from trauma, anxiety, depression, repeated stress, and often all the above.” – Shani-Lee Wallis

About the author
Shani-Lee grew up in Newcastle, UK. The sexual abuse and bullying she suffered as a child led to a frightening battle with bulimia. When Shani-Lee emigrated to Arizona, US, she started to unpeel the complex layers of emotions and behaviours her traumatic childhood had sparked.
